Subject: Key rotation for the Importly CSV wizard — action needed

Hi, and welcome aboard!

Quick heads up before you start on the CSV import wizard: we rotated the keys for the internal validation service this week, so any examples in the old docs will fail with auth errors. Don't waste time debugging that — it's just the rotation. Update your local env file and you should be good. The current key for the validation service is below.

gateway credential: kto3_qfe

Subject: Catalogue import status for weekly sync

Hi Tallowbrook integration team,

Quick update ahead of the sync: the Pinefold library catalogue import is now processing MARC batches hourly instead of nightly. Duplicate detection runs on title plus edition, so please normalise edition fields before upload. Failed records land in the review queue with reason codes. For test submissions against our staging ingest endpoint, authenticate with the bearer token below.

session JWT of yawep-yawep = eyJhbGciOiJIUzI1NiIsInR5cCI6IkpXVCJ9.eyJzdWIiOiI3pWF3_In0.aXYsHiog

## Step 4: Vendor third-party fonts

Copy the licensed Glyphhaven font bundle into assets/fonts before building Larkspur. Do not pull fonts at runtime; the CDN fallback was removed in 3.2. Verify checksums with the vendored manifest, then run the asset pipeline once. The font license server check during build needs its access credential, which goes on the line below.

sealed setting: COURIER_KEY29=170ad45524657711572101e080d15